**Mgmt Meeting Minutes — Retiring the Brightline Range**

Quick recap for sales leads at Fenholt Supplies: we agreed to retire the Brightline fixture range by year-end. Remaining stock moves to clearance pricing next month, and accounts on standing orders get migrated to the Lumetta range. Trade-in incentives were approved in principle. The confidential note on next steps sits just below.

board note of bajof-bajeg: The pricing group signed off on a budget of $13.4 million for Project Sildor. The renewal with Lamixek Holdings closes at $48.9 million a year, 49 percent above the last contract.

## Harden watchdog restart logic for the Lanternbox kiosk app

This change tightens the Lanternbox watchdog so a crashing kiosk cannot enter a rapid restart loop that masks tampering. Restarts are now rate-limited with exponential backoff, each restart is logged with a signed reason code, and repeated failures escalate to a locked maintenance screen rather than silent relaunch. The thresholds governing this behavior are defined below.

tuning table, kajog-kawef:
PRIORITIES = {
    "kelox": 870,
    "kasix": 89,
    "eliax": 988,
}

Ticket: Missed pick-up — trophy engraving

Driver did not collect the engraved trophies from Calderstone Engravers yesterday. Awards night at the Fennimore Hall is Friday; no slack left. Shop closes at 17:00. Need re-dispatch today, morning slot preferred. Items are boxed and signed off, twelve trophies plus two plaques. Confirm driver assignment by 10:00. Flag this as priority in the run sheet. Hand-over instruction for the courier is below.

handover note for yagef-bagep: the drudor pelius courier leaves the kasdor zorvan norir ledger at gate 8016 under passcode 755406

TURN-208: Gatevale turnstile counters at the Merrow Field pilot double-count when a rotation reverses mid-cycle. Attendance totals drift roughly 2% high per event. The debounce window fix is implemented, reviewed by Ilsa, and soak-tested across two simulated match days without drift. Ready for your cut; the candidate build is identified below.

trace token, tagag-tafog: htk6_5ed18c